css – 如何在IE10中的风格

前端之家收集整理的这篇文章主要介绍了css – 如何在IE10中的风格前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我想要设置< input type ='range'/>元素在IE10.

默认情况下,IE 10样式如下:

我想定制一下,比如说,将颜色蓝色变成红色,灰色变成黑色,小酒吧变黄,小黑色洗涤器变白.我尝试覆盖CSS中的background-color属性和color属性.但它没有奏效.

有任何想法吗?

解决方法

有许多伪元素可用于在IE10中创建范围控件.
input[type="range"]::-ms-fill-upper {
    background-color: green;
}

拇指后会涂抹部分.拇指使用前的风格:

input[type="range"]::-ms-fill-lower {
    background-color: lime green;
}

参见例如http://jsfiddle.net/K8WyC/4/

要缩放大拇指,您可以使用:: – ms-thumb,而刻度标记可以用:: – ms-ticks-before,:: – ms-ticks-after或:: – ms-track(后者风格双方).您可以在http://msdn.microsoft.com/en-us/library/ie/hh869604(v=vs.85).aspx找到有关控件的各种伪元素的更多信息

你要求的风格可以像下面的小提琴一样实现:http://jsfiddle.net/K8WyC/8/

猜你在找的CSS相关文章